Network Operations Center (NOC) Technician
Description
NOC technicians are responsible for monitoring FRII and customer
systems and networks in real time and diagnosing minor and major
errors 24/7/365. This position provides quality
customer service and support for FRII's dedicated customers and are
a technical escalation point for FRII's Customer Support team.
Requirements:
- Strong understanding of multiple Operating Systems, GUI and Command line interfaces
- Basic understanding of telco technology
- Exceptional customer service skills
- Excellent troubleshooting/problem solving skills
- Basic networking understanding
- Understanding of the Internet and its technologies
- High level of professionalism
Responsibilities:
- Real-time monitoring of FRII and customer systems, networks and services
- Manage mail abuse issues
- Troubleshoot network problems with Vendor/Providers in emergency situations
- Maintain/update data for network/system monitoring and response
- Provide dedicated customers with telephone technical support
Experience in the following are a plus:
- VoIP
- DSL, Dialup, Wireless networks, ISDN
- LANs, IP routing, VLANS
- POP, IMAP, DNS, SMTP, Apache
